Sanguisorba Officinalis
''Sanguisorba officinalis'', commonly known as great burnet, is a plant in the family Rosaceae, subfamily Rosoideae. It is native throughout the cooler regions of the Northern Hemisphere in Europe, northern Asia, and northern North America. It is a herbaceous perennial plant growing to 1 m tall, which occurs in grasslands, growing well on grassy banks. It flowers June or July. ''Sanguisorba officinalis'' is an important food plant for the European large blue butterflies '' Phengaris nausithous'' and '' P. teleius''.World Conservation Monitoring Centre 1996. . Downloaded on 6 October 2010 Commercial uses Use is made of its extensive root system for erosion control, as well as a bioremediator, used to reclaim derelict sites such as landfills. Ornamental ''Sanguisorba officinalis'' is one of several ''Sanguisorba'' species cultivated as ornamental plants. Carl Linnaeus
Carl Linnaeus (; 23 May 1707 – 10 January 1778), also known after his Nobility#Ennoblement, ennoblement in 1761 as Carl von Linné#Blunt, Blunt (2004), p. 171. (), was a Swedish botanist, zoologist, taxonomist, and physician who formalised binomial nomenclature, the modern system of naming organisms. He is known as the "father of modern Taxonomy (biology), taxonomy". Many of his writings were in Latin; his name is rendered in Latin as and, after his 1761 ennoblement, as . Linnaeus was born in Råshult, the countryside of Småland, in southern Sweden. He received most of his higher education at Uppsala University and began giving lectures in botany there in 1730. He lived abroad between 1735 and 1738, where he studied and also published the first edition of his ' in the Netherlands. Royal Horticultural Society
The Royal Horticultural Society (RHS), founded in 1804 as the Horticultural Society of London, is the UK's leading gardening charity. The RHS promotes horticulture through its five gardens at Wisley (Surrey), Hyde Hall (Essex), Harlow Carr (North Yorkshire), Rosemoor (Devon) and Bridgewater (Greater Manchester); flower shows including the Chelsea Flower Show, Hampton Court Palace Flower Show, Tatton Park Flower Show and Cardiff Flower Show; community gardening schemes; Britain in Bloom and a vast educational programme. It also supports training for professional and amateur gardeners. the president was Keith Weed and the director general was Sue Biggs CBE. History Founders The creation of a British horticultural society was suggested by John Wedgwood (son of Josiah Wedgwood) in 1800. Medicinal Plants
Medicinal plants, also called medicinal herbs, have been discovered and used in traditional medicine practices since prehistoric times. Plants synthesize hundreds of chemical compounds for various functions, including defense and protection against insects, fungi, diseases, and herbivorous mammals. The earliest historical records of herbs are found from the Sumerian civilization, where hundreds of medicinal plants including opium are listed on clay tablets, c. 3000 BC. The Ebers Papyrus from ancient Egypt, c. 1550 BC, describes over 850 plant medicines. The Greek physician Dioscorides, who worked in the Roman army, documented over 1000 recipes for medicines using over 600 medicinal plants in ''De materia medica'', c. 60 AD; this formed the basis of pharmacopoeias for some 1500 years. Sanguisorba
''Sanguisorba'' is a genus of flowering plants in the family Rosaceae native to the temperate regions of the Northern Hemisphere. The common name is burnet. Description The plants are herbaceous perennials or small shrubs. The stems grow to 50–200 cm tall and have a cluster of basal leaves, with further leaves arranged alternately up the stem. The leaves are pinnate, 5–30 cm long, with 7-25 leaflets, the leaflets with a serrated margin. Young leaves grow from the crown in the center of the plant. The flowers are small, produced in dense clusters 5–20 mm long; each flower has four very small petals, white to red in colour. Triterpenoid Saponin
Saponins (Latin "sapon", soap + "-in", one of), also selectively referred to as triterpene glycosides, are bitter-tasting usually toxic plant-derived organic chemicals that have a foamy quality when agitated in water. They are widely distributed but found particularly in soapwort (genus Saponaria), a flowering plant, the soapbark tree (''Quillaja saponaria'') and soybeans (''Glycine max'' L.). They are used in soaps, medicinals, fire extinguishers, speciously as dietary supplements, for synthesis of steroids, and in carbonated beverages (the head on a mug of root beer). Structurally, they are glycosides, sugars bonded to another organic molecule, usually a steroid or triterpene, a steroid building block. Saponins are both water and fat soluble, which gives them their useful soap properties. Ellagitannin
The ellagitannins are a diverse class of hydrolyzable tannins, a type of polyphenol formed primarily from the oxidative linkage of galloyl groups in 1,2,3,4,6-pentagalloyl glucose. Ellagitannins differ from gallotannins, in that their galloyl groups are linked through C-C bonds, whereas the galloyl groups in gallotannins are linked by depside bonds. Ellagitannins contain various numbers of hexahydroxydiphenoyl units, as well as galloyl units and/or sanguisorboyl units bounded to sugar moiety. In order to determine the quantity of every individual unit, the hydrolysis of the extracts with trifluoroacetic acid in methanol/water system is performed. Hexahydroxydiphenic acid, created after hydrolysis, spontaneously lactonized to ellagic acid, and sanguisorbic acid to sanguisorbic acid dilactone, while gallic acid remains intact. Dimer (chemistry)
A dimer () ('' di-'', "two" + ''-mer'', "parts") is an oligomer consisting of two monomers joined by bonds that can be either strong or weak, covalent or intermolecular. Dimers also have significant implications in polymer chemistry, inorganic chemistry, and biochemistry. The term ''homodimer'' is used when the two molecules are identical (e.g. A–A) and ''heterodimer'' when they are not (e.g. A–B). The reverse of dimerization is often called dissociation. When two oppositely charged ions associate into dimers, they are referred to as ''Bjerrum pairs'', after Niels Bjerrum. Noncovalent dimers Anhydrous carboxylic acids form dimers by hydrogen bonding of the acidic hydrogen and the carbonyl oxygen. For example, acetic acid forms a dimer in the gas phase, where the monomer units are held together by hydrogen bonds. Sanguiin H-6
Sanguiin H-6 is an ellagitannin. Natural occurrence Sanguiin H-6 can be found in Rosaceae such as the great burnet (''Sanguisorba officinalis''), in strawberries (''Fragaria × ananassa'') and in ''Rubus'' species such as red raspberries (''Rubus idaeus'') or cloudberries ('' Rubus chamaemorus''). Topical
A topical medication is a medication that is applied to a particular place on or in the body. Most often topical medication means application to body surfaces such as the skin or mucous membranes to treat ailments via a large range of classes including creams, foams, gels, lotions, and ointments. Many topical medications are epicutaneous, meaning that they are applied directly to the skin. Topical medications may also be inhalational, such as asthma medications, or applied to the surface of tissues other than the skin, such as eye drops applied to the conjunctiva, or ear drops placed in the ear, or medications applied to the surface of a tooth. Dysentery
Dysentery (UK pronunciation: , US: ), historically known as the bloody flux, is a type of gastroenteritis that results in bloody diarrhea. Other symptoms may include fever, abdominal pain, and a feeling of incomplete defecation. Complications may include dehydration. The cause of dysentery is usually the bacteria from genus ''Shigella'', in which case it is known as shigellosis, or the amoeba '' Entamoeba histolytica''; then it is called amoebiasis. Other causes may include certain chemicals, other bacteria, other protozoa, or parasitic worms. It may spread between people. Risk factors include contamination of food and water with feces due to poor sanitation. The underlying mechanism involves inflammation of the intestine, especially of the colon. Efforts to prevent dysentery include hand washing and food safety measures while traveling in areas of high risk. Blood
Blood is a body fluid in the circulatory system of humans and other vertebrates that delivers necessary substances such as nutrients and oxygen to the cells, and transports metabolic waste products away from those same cells. Blood in the circulatory system is also known as ''peripheral blood'', and the blood cells it carries, ''peripheral blood cells''. Blood is composed of blood cells suspended in blood plasma. Plasma, which constitutes 55% of blood fluid, is mostly water (92% by volume), and contains proteins, glucose, mineral ions, hormones, carbon dioxide (plasma being the main medium for excretory product transportation), and blood cells themselves. Albumin is the main protein in plasma, and it functions to regulate the colloidal osmotic pressure of blood. The blood cells are mainly red blood cells (also called RBCs or erythrocytes), white blood cells (also called WBCs or leukocytes) and platelets (also called thrombocytes).
